Designers are like doctors. Doctors treat you according to how you tell them you are feeling. If you explain yourself badly chances are, you will be diagnosed wrongly. Thus, you should explain what you want clearly to your designer. To make it easier, your designer may ask you questions regarding the type of property you want. It is purpose, your budget and others. Make sure you answer appropriately to avoid future frustrations.

You have probably heard of individuals who had their designers draft the design they wanted but after it was built they were not satisfied because it was completely differently from what they wanted. This happens when you hire a contractor or a project manager that does not understand your design. To avoid this, make your designer in charge of the project.
